The job itself was amazing, management made everything else a nightmare. - Customer Service Xanterra Employee Review

Pros

Meeting people from all around the world, very fun, great people-skills building. Lots of opportunities if you enjoy nature, exploring, and travelling. They are very conscious about their environmental impact. They have some fantastic policies and ideas for being "green". I am far from your typical "tree hughing hippie", but they talk the talk, and they really do walk the walk when it comes to recycling, using cleaner products, water and electricity consumption, and sustainability. Seriously, their "Ecologix" program is worthy of every award they've gotten. The Environmental Director at my location is absolutely fantastic and a great guy. Worth every penny they pay him, in my opinion.

Cons

They treat their lower end (read: the ones busting their tails every day) employees like absolute garbage. They micro-manage every detail of your job. Creativity, new ideas, and constructive criticism is not allowed, and you will be punished accordingly for not towing the company line. I was discriminated against and terminated despite following all written company procedures. My manager, when she terminated me, said "it doesn't matter" when I said I followed all written procedures. I had a very strong case for a wrongful termination lawsuit, but I have other family and very close friends that either work for Xanterra in other positions, or have their own business that relies on Xanterra's blessing to operate. I have no doubt that had I pursued legal action, retaliation would have occurred against them. Various departments are managed by nothing but "yes men/women". Nobody has the stones to question decisions made by upper management. But obedience is rewarded with promotions and raises. My manager got 3 promotions to positions that didn't exist before. She was compensated very, very well. She could take vacations on a regular basis, much more than any of us. For benefits, they have a very tight hold on what you are eligible for. When I was hired, we could accumulate 96 hours of sick time as a full time employee. A couple years ago, they slashed that by half, only allowing 48 hours. They claimed this was offset by giving us "free short-term disability." The problem with this is that short-term disability only pays 80% of your normal wage (and we were all minimum wage), still has medical benefits deducted, and taxes deducted. Also, certain criteria must be met to claim this. You couldn't just get sick for 3 or 4 days (happens a lot given the exposure to worldwide travelers) and use this. 48 hours with our schedule (11 paid hours a day) only gave us 4 days off for illnesses a year. 4 days. Really? For wages, longevity as an employee is not rewarded. I was hired at $7.25/hour when minimum wage was $7.15. The following January 1st, MW went to $7.25. I then got my yearly "review", and got an $0.11 raise (for "meeting or exceeding company standards" in every category). The following 1/1, MW went to $7.35. My next yearly review got me to $7.43. The following 1/1, you guessed it, MW went to $7.65. My wage went to $7.73, keeping an $0.08 gap. Upon my yearly review, I received no "performance wage increase", amd the reasoning given was "you already got your raise when minimum wage went up." The following 1/1, MW went to $7.80, and now my gap was gone. Over 4 years of full time service, and I was worth the same as the person hired yesterday. No loyalty for tenure. "Perks" for tenure always got moved to just longer than most of us had been employeed. Overall, the suits in the offices are so out of touch with the working class making the company their profits it's not even funny.
